Course Content

• Introduction to Biomaterials: Fundamentals and Classification
• Biocompatibility Testing and Regulations (ISO 10993)
• Biomaterial-Cell Interactions: Cell adhesion, proliferation, and differentiation
• Polymer Biomaterials: Synthesis, characterization, and applications
• Ceramic and Metallic Biomaterials: Properties and biomedical applications
• Biomaterial Degradation and Bioresorbability
• Tissue Engineering and Regenerative Medicine using Biomaterials
• Advanced Biomaterials: Nanomaterials and hydrogels
• Biomaterial Applications in Drug Delivery
• Case Studies in Biomaterial Selection and Design

Biomaterials & Biocompatibility Job Market in the UK

Career Role (Biomaterials & Biocompatibility) Description
Biomaterials Scientist Develops and tests new biomaterials for medical applications, focusing on biocompatibility and performance. High industry demand.
Biomedical Engineer (Biomaterials Focus) Designs and develops medical devices incorporating biocompatible materials, ensuring functionality and safety. Strong salary prospects.
Regulatory Affairs Specialist (Biomaterials) Ensures compliance with regulatory requirements for biomaterials and medical devices. Essential for successful product launch.
Research Scientist (Biocompatibility) Conducts research on biocompatibility testing methods and assesses the interactions between materials and biological systems. Growing field.
